How to Reach Renswoude, Netherlands

Renswoude is a charming village located in the province of Utrecht, Netherlands. If you're planning a visit to this picturesque destination, here are some ways to reach Renswoude:

By Air

If you're coming from abroad, the nearest major international airport is Amsterdam Airport Schiphol. From there, you can take a train or rent a car to reach Renswoude. The journey by car takes approximately 1 hour, while the train journey can take around 1.5 hours with a transfer at Utrecht Centraal.

By Train

Renswoude does not have a train station of its own, but you can easily reach the village by taking a train to Veenendaal-De Klomp station. This station is well-connected to major cities in the Netherlands, including Amsterdam, Utrecht, and Arnhem. From Veenendaal-De Klomp, you can either take a taxi or a bus to reach Renswoude, which is just a short distance away.

By Car

If you prefer to drive, Renswoude is conveniently located near major highways. From Amsterdam, you can take the A1 and A30 highways, which will lead you directly to the village. The drive from Amsterdam takes approximately 1 hour, depending on traffic conditions. Similarly, if you're coming from Utrecht, you can take the A12 and A30 highways to reach Renswoude in about 30 minutes.

By Bus

Renswoude is well-served by bus connections from nearby towns and cities. You can check the local bus schedules and routes to find the most convenient option for your journey. The bus station in Renswoude is centrally located, making it easy to explore the village and its surroundings on foot.

Getting to know Renswoude

Renswoude is a small municipality located in the province of Utrecht, Netherlands. It is situated in the central part of the country and is known for its picturesque landscapes and charming rural atmosphere. Renswoude is surrounded by beautiful forests and farmlands, making it an ideal destination for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ts.

The history of Renswoude dates back to the Middle Ages when it was a small village. Over the years, it has grown into a thriving community with a population of around 5,000 people. Despite its small size, Renswoude offers a range of amenities and facilities to its residents and visitors.

One of the main attractions in Renswoude is the Castle Renswoude, a stunning historical building that dates back to the 17th century. The castle is surrounded by beautiful gardens and is open to the public for tours and events. It provides a glimpse into the rich history of the region and offers a unique experience for visitors.

In addition to its historical sites, Renswoude also has a vibrant cultural scene. The municipality hosts various events and festivals throughout the year, showcasing local art, music, and traditions. These events bring the community together and provide entertainment for both residents and tourists.
